The Role of Mindfulness

Mindfulness is one of the most accessible and widely practiced techniques for achieving enlightenment. It involves being fully present in the moment, cultivating awareness without judgment. By practicing mindfulness, individuals can observe their thoughts and emotions without getting caught up in them.

Practicing Mindfulness

  1. Breath Awareness: Start with simple breath awareness exercises. Sit comfortably and focus on your breathing. Notice the sensation of air entering and leaving your body. This practice helps anchor you in the present moment.

  2. Body Scan: Conduct a body scan by progressively focusing on different parts of your body, from your toes to the crown of your head. Acknowledge any sensations or tensions you feel without trying to change them.

  3. Mindful Walking: Take a walk while paying attention to each step you take. Feel the ground beneath your feet, notice the rhythm of your breath, and observe your surroundings with curiosity.

By integrating mindfulness into your daily life, you create space for greater awareness and profound insights about yourself and your environment.

The Power of Meditation

Meditation is another powerful technique for personal growth and enlightenment. It provides a structured way to explore inner landscapes and cultivate mental clarity. Many forms of meditation exist, each with its unique approach to fostering awareness.

Exploring Different Types of Meditation

  1. Focused Attention Meditation: In this form of meditation, you concentrate on a single point of focus—such as your breath or a mantra—while gently bringing your attention back whenever distractions arise.

  2. Transcendental Meditation: This technique involves repeating a specific mantra to quiet the mind, allowing deeper states of consciousness to emerge.

  3. Loving-Kindness Meditation (Metta): This practice promotes compassion by silently repeating phrases wishing well-being to oneself and others.

  4. Zen Meditation (Zazen): In Zazen, practitioners sit in silence while observing their thoughts and sensations without attachment or aversion.

Incorporating meditation into your routine can lead to increased self-awareness, emotional regulation, and overall well-being.

Journaling for Self-Discovery

Journaling serves as an excellent tool for self-reflection and exploring one’s thoughts and emotions more deeply. Writing enables you to articulate feelings that may otherwise remain unexpressed and helps clarify complex ideas swirling in your mind.

Effective Journaling Techniques

  1. Stream-of-Consciousness Writing: Set a timer for 10-15 minutes and write without stopping or censoring yourself. Allow your thoughts to flow freely onto the page; this can reveal hidden feelings or insights.

  2. Gratitude Journaling: Each day, write down three things you are grateful for. This practice shifts your focus from negative aspects of life to positive experiences, fostering a sense of contentment.

  3. Goal-Oriented Journaling: Outline your goals or intentions for personal growth, then explore the steps needed to achieve them. Reflect on progress regularly to maintain motivation.

Through journaling, you cultivate clarity around your aspirations while also processing emotions that arise on your journey toward enlightenment.

Embracing Nature

Nature has an inherent ability to ground us and facilitate moments of clarity amidst chaos. By immersing ourselves in natural settings, we can reconnect with ourselves and gain fresh perspectives on our lives.

Nature-Based Practices

  1. Nature Walks: Spend time walking in nature without distractions—leave behind phones or gadgets—and focus on observing the sights, sounds, and smells around you.

  2. Forest Bathing (Shinrin-Yoku): This Japanese practice encourages spending time in forests while engaging all senses to absorb the experience fully.

  3. Gardening: Cultivating plants connects us with nature’s cycles while providing opportunities for mindfulness through tending to living things.

Engaging with nature allows for introspection and rejuvenation—the perfect combination for personal growth.
